There’s something strangely defiant—almost subversive—about loving a “Complete Works” edition in 2025. In a world where literature streams at the speed of thought and everything is searchable, hyperlinkable, and endlessly fragmentable, I find myself drawn to the most monolithic of formats: the heavy, dignified, clothbound volume that declares: here, at last, is everything.
